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A water reclamation method on the basis of integrated use of magnetic resin adsorption and electrosorption is provided. It belongs to the water reclamation field, including the following steps: pump the biotreated effluent into a reactor that is filled with magnetic resin particles so that the chromaticity, organic pollutants, total nitrogen, total phosphorus contained in the wastewater can be effectively reduced; channel the fully reacted mixture into a precipitation tank for separation; part of the separated magnetic resin is pumped back into the reactor while the rest of the separated magnetic resin flows into a regeneration tank; the wastewater treated by magnetic resin adsorption then flows into an electrosorption unit for a desalting process; the remaining organic pollutants and inorganic pollutants are further removed.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

The invention claimed is: 1. A water reclamation method based on integrated use of magnetic resin adsorption and electrosorption, comprising the following steps: (1) pumping a biotreated effluent for further advanced treatment into a reactor that is filled with magnetic resin particles; maintaining a temperature at 10˜60° C. and making sure the contact reaction between the magnetic resin and the biotreated effluent is carried out; (2) channelling a wastewater that has undergone sufficient mixing and reaction with the magnetic resin in the reactor into a precipitation tank for precipitation; separating the precipitated magnetic resin from the wastewater through filtration; pumping 60%˜80% of the precipitated magnetic resin back into the reactor and a remainder portion of the precipitated magnetic resin is regenerated into a regeneration tank, wherein the precipitated magnetic resin is regenerated and then sent back to the reactor for reuse; (3) channelling the wastewater that has undergone the filtration mentioned in step (2) into an electrosorption unit so that a double-layer capacitance generated on a surface of an electrosorptive electrode by operating voltage can be utilized on a basis of electrostatic adsorption to adsorb charged ions contained in the wastewater that has been treated by magnetic resin and undergone the filtration mentioned in step (2); after completion of the whole process of wastewater treatment, turning off the operating voltage, channeling 2-5 L tap water into the electrosorption unit to desorb the electrode under a short circuit condition. 2. The water reclamation method based on integrated use of magnetic resin adsorption and electrosorption as defined in claim 1 , wherein the magnetic resin used in said step (1) is magnetic strong base anion exchange resin with a polyacrylic matrix. 3. The water reclamation method based on integrated use of magnetic resin adsorption and electrosorption as defined in said claim 1 , wherein in step (1) the volume ratio between said magnetic resin and the wastewater is 1:100˜300. 4. The water reclamation method based on integrated use of magnetic resin adsorption and electrosorption as defined in claim 1 , wherein in said step (1) a hydraulic retention time of the wastewater within the resin reactor is 10˜60 min, and a liquid-solid contact is realized through mechanical or pneumatic stirring. 5. The water reclamation method based on integrated use of magnetic resin adsorption and electrosorption as defined in claim 1 , wherein in said step (2), 5%˜20% by mass NaCl solution is added as regeneration agent into the regeneration tank, and the wastewater generated in a resin desorption process is then treated with coagulation or membrane techniques. 6. The water reclamation method based on integrated use of magnetic resin adsorption and electrosorption as defined in claim 1 , wherein in said step (3) the electrode of the electrosorption unit is made from activated carbon, carbon black and polytetrafluoroethylene in the ratio of 5-16:2-3:2. 7. The water reclamation method based on integrated use of magnetic resin adsorption and electrosorption as defined in claim 6 , wherein in said step (3) the electrode is supplied with an operating voltage of 1.5˜2.0 v. 8. The water reclamation method based on integrated use of magnetic resin adsorption and electrosorption as defined in claim 5 , wherein a concentration of major quality indicators in the original biotreated effluent is: a critical chemical oxygen demand (CODcr) lower than 150 ppm, a chromaticity lower than 100°, and a total salt lower than 5000 ppm.
